Several key factors are propelling the growth of the cured polyurethane cleaning solvent market. The expansion of the automotive industry, with its increasing use of polyurethane in interior components, exterior parts, and advanced driver-assistance systems (ADAS), significantly contributes to the demand for effective cleaning solutions. Similarly, the electronics sector's growing reliance on polyurethane in protective coatings, encapsulants, and flexible circuits fuels the need for specialized cleaning solvents that are compatible with sensitive electronic components. The medical industry's use of polyurethane in implants, catheters, and other medical devices mandates stringent cleaning protocols, further driving demand for high-quality solvents. Beyond these primary application areas, the growing adoption of polyurethane in various consumer products such as furniture, footwear, and sporting goods creates additional demand. Furthermore, advancements in solvent technology, leading to the development of more efficient, environmentally friendly, and safer cleaning solutions, are also contributing to market growth. This includes the introduction of biodegradable solvents, water-based formulations, and solvents with reduced VOC content, aligning with increasing environmental regulations and sustainability initiatives. Government regulations concerning worker safety and environmental protection are also driving the adoption of safer and more environmentally compliant cleaning solvents, further stimulating market expansion.
Despite the significant growth potential, the cured polyurethane cleaning solvent market faces several challenges. The fluctuating prices of raw materials, including solvents and additives, can impact production costs and profitability. Stringent environmental regulations and safety standards necessitate significant investments in research and development to create environmentally friendly and compliant solvents. The stringent regulatory landscape regarding the use and disposal of solvents poses a significant barrier for market players. This includes compliance with VOC emission limits, waste disposal regulations, and worker safety standards. Competition from alternative cleaning methods, such as ultrasonic cleaning or plasma cleaning, presents a challenge to the traditional solvent-based cleaning methods. Moreover, the need for specialized cleaning solvents for specific polyurethane formulations increases the complexity of solvent development and production. The diversity of polyurethane materials and applications necessitates the development of a wide range of specialized solvents, which can be both costly and time-consuming. Furthermore, concerns about worker health and safety associated with solvent exposure require strict adherence to safety protocols and the implementation of appropriate protective measures.

Alkaline cleaning solvents are anticipated to hold a larger market share compared to acid cleaning solvents due to their versatility, effectiveness on a broad range of polyurethane types, and generally lower environmental impact compared to acid-based alternatives. However, the choice between alkaline and acid solvents depends heavily on the specific polyurethane type and the nature of the soiling.
The Electronics Industry segment is also a significant contributor, due to the precision cleaning requirements for polyurethane components in electronic devices. The demand for high-purity solvents in this industry is expected to drive the market for specialized, high-performance cleaning agents.
The Medical Industry segment, although smaller compared to automotive and electronics, is experiencing considerable growth owing to the stringent cleanliness standards required in the medical device manufacturing and sterilization processes. The need for biocompatible and non-toxic solvents in this sector is a significant driver. Stricter regulations and increasing quality standards in healthcare contribute to this segment’s growth potential.
